Some people think that politicians have the greatest influence on the world IELTS Writing Task 2 is an opinion based essay. The three sample answers have been provided below. Answers begin with the overview of the topic. The sample answers include 3 parts: introduction, body and conclusion. The introduction includes an overview on the topic. The body discusses both the views on the topic. The conclusion will have the opinion of the candidate.
IELTS writing task 2 evaluates candidates based on the knowledge and views they have expressed. The areas that candidates are assessed on are grammar, vocabulary, and style. IELTS writing score is marked based on band scores. The band scores range from 0 to 9. Topic: Some people think that politicians have the greatest influence on the world, while others believe that scientists are more influential. Discuss both sides of view and give your opinion.

Band 7 IELTS Essay

Influence has a crucial role in moulding and remaking the globe in the linked world of today. People will frequently be persuaded by powerful figures or well-known individuals, indicating that this is human nature. This is the reason that arguments have welled up among people for the superiority of the politicians and the scientists over one another.Many individuals believe that politicians have significant influence over the general course of society. However, other people believe that scientists are the real motivators.Politicians cannot advance the country without scientific inventions, so in my opinion, scientists have more sway than politicians. The subject will be thoroughly examined in this article. First, via development, a nation gains recognition on a global scale, and these developments are made possible by scientific contributions to the country. Additionally, scientists are responsible for all the modern conveniences that people take for granted, such as the internet, cars, and electricity.Without the advances in science and technology, we would not be where we are today. Scientists have developed medicines and vaccines that can save lives and give us a chance to fend off fatal diseases. They made the first autos, refrigerators, light bulbs, and computers. As we can see, life without these inventions is unimaginable in the present. The development of corona vaccinations is another recent scientific success. To sum up, people are making their lives safer and easier thanks to scientists and their discoveries.

Secondly, politicians play a crucial role in serving the public.The first and most important reason is that they use laws and regulations to efficiently and successfully govern the nation. Additionally, they uphold law and order for the protection of citizens. They enhance infrastructure, healthcare facilities, and educational institutions to improve people's quality of life. Despite their management skills, they are unable to accomplish their objective without the assistance of scientists. For instance, all of the world's leaders attempted to control the pandemic scenario, but they were unable until the development of vaccines. Additionally, despite the fact that politicians have sworn to safeguard the country, scientists have really created atomic weapons and other weapons like.

Band 6 IELTS Essay

In the modern period, there is a contentious debate about whether scientists have controlled the world or whether leaders have intrigued the public with policies and administer laws. Therefore, both points of view would be discussed. Examining the earlier viewpoint, the first justification offered by its proponents is that scientists create breakthrough innovations. To put it another way, the members of this fraternity's intellectual community are to be blamed for all the revolutionary discoveries and creations. These have changed the course of human history, including the telephone, internet, and computers.

This has significantly impacted the general populace's standard of living and led to a convenient and hassle-free life. In addition, scientists are credited for advancing technology. To be more specific, the development of science and technology has benefited every aspect of human life. This includes agriculture, manufacturing, defence, education, and commerce. Without scientists, today's humanity would lead a simple, agrarian lifestyle.

Opponents of this viewpoint, however, contend that politicians are more powerful globally. mostly because of their ability to pass laws. To put it another way, political candidates create laws and policies that influence both the bourgeois and the elite, not to mention companies. Parliamentarians also have authority over the budget. This indicates that most of the world is

democratic and that the government has the authority to distribute monies in a given area. The entire neighbourhood is consequently either directly or indirectly impacted. For instance, according to study, the top decision-makers in the world's five largest economies can affect the entire planet.Citizens elect politicians to strive for the general welfare by enforcing laws that uphold social peace and the rule of law in the nation. They work hard to ensure that everyone has access to their fundamental rights because they stand in for the average person. They also speak on behalf of their nations when international cooperation is required. They have the ability to alter their country's standing around the world. In conclusion, it can be said that both science and leadership have a powerful hold in technological advancement and the stability of global rules and systems.

Band 8.5 IELTS Essay

Many populations now live better lives than in the past, thanks to politicians and scientists who supported the advancements of society. While some say that the contributions of the scientists are the reason why people live in sophisticated cities, others hold that politicians significant. I concur with the latter viewpoint. Some people hold the opinion that scientists have contributed significantly to society. First of all, professionals can create significant improvements through their inventions, such as electronics or water supply systems. By creating the steam engine, for example, they helped to spark the industrial revolution, which changed not only how people behaved but also how they thought. In other words, they played an important role in the evolution of centuries. Some think that politicians have the power to change society in a variety of ways. In comparison to scientists who specialise in one area of study, politicians deal with a variety of issues. The development of the quality of life is also greatly influenced by politics. An analyst, for instance, may develop novel techniques or technologies, but it may be difficult to implement them across all countries. In this sense, legislators have the power to pass legislation mandating the use of new technologies in urban settings, with the potential to alter daily life for citizens.

Additionally, there is a risk that large organisations or a specific scientist could monopolise the use of the most sophisticated talents. Instead, by passing legislation, politicians avoid these scenarios.

In conclusion, scientists are considerably more influential since they can find solutions for medical, food, and environmental issues. Athough politicians do have a notable impact by causing and preventing wars around the world. Because of this, I wholeheartedly concur that, in contrast to their political counterparts, scientists have the biggest influence on this globe.
